price changes to 2 year contracts.  I just entered my 3rd 2 year contract with xfinity.  For the prior 2 contracts, the price stayed the same for the duration of the contract.  This time I received a 5% increase just 3 months into the contract.  I did a session online and was told that I am still locked into the 2 year contract, but xfinity can still raise the price whenever they feel like it.  Is this a common issue?  Is the 2 year contract a bait and switch deal now?

Great question thanks for reaching out to us as a customer myself I'm always concerned with my billing is more than I expected. What's guaranteed to not change is your promotional discount but equipment taxes and fees are always subject to change

 

. Generally every year around the first of the year there are changes made to our services that could increase the bills or could lower the cost.

To clarify,  what is locked in for two years or three years is your bundle discount or the discount you get on your actual services,  equipment taxes and fees are always subject to change.

 

 

so your prices could increase or decrease at the beginning of every year. But anytime there's changes to our services we do list that information on your November and December bill on the last page.
